*{margin:0}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if}.input-form-wrapper{align-items:center;background-color:#fefefe;border-bottom:1px solid #e6e6e6;display:flex}.dropdown-arrow{margin:20px}.add-task-field{border:none;box-sizing:border-box;display:block;font-family:M_Ying_Hei_HK_W3;font-size:45px;outline:none;padding:34px 25px;width:100%}.add-task-field::placeholder{color:#e6e6e6;font-style:italic;font-weight:100;letter-spacing:1.1px}.task-item{align-items:center;background-color:#fefefe;border-bottom:2px solid #e6e6e6;color:#4d4d4d;display:flex;font-family:M_Ying_Hei_HK_W3;font-size:50px;letter-spacing:-1px;padding:23.5px 15px;-webkit-user-select:none;user-select:none}.task-item-marker{background-color:#fff;margin-right:44px;min-width:61px}.completed-task{color:#d9d9d9;-webkit-text-decoration-line:underline;text-decoration-line:underline;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none;text-decoration-thickness:3px;text-underline-offset:-40%}.task-list{list-style:none;padding:0}.footer{align-items:center;background-color:#fff;display:flex;justify-content:space-between;margin-bottom:-18px;padding:13px 30px;position:relative;z-index:10}.footer:after,.footer:before{background-color:#f6f6f6;box-shadow:0 1px 3px #0000001a,0 1px 2px #0003;content:"";height:8px;left:8px;position:absolute;right:8px;top:100%;z-index:-1}.footer:before{opacity:.9;transform:scale(1)}.footer:after{left:16px;opacity:.8;right:16px;top:calc(100% + 8px);transform:scale(1);z-index:-2}.footer-buttons{display:flex;gap:30px}.footer-buttons .button{left:34px;padding:6px 12px;position:relative}.items-left-text{font-size:27px;letter-spacing:.5px}.button,.items-left-text{color:#777;font-family:M_Ying_Hei_HK_W3}.button{background-color:initial;border:none;cursor:pointer;font-size:26px;letter-spacing:.8px}.footer-buttons .button.active{border:2px solid #ecd7d7;border-radius:8px}.app-container{align-items:center;background-color:#fff;display:flex;justify-content:center;padding:30px 0}.app{background-color:#f5f5f5;width:1106px}.app-title{color:#e9d9d8;font-family:Helvetica Now Display;font-size:200px;font-weight:100;line-height:100%;margin:30px 0;text-align:center;-webkit-user-select:none;user-select:none}.app-main{box-shadow:0 10px 12px -5px #0003;margin:0 auto;position:relative;z-index:15}.app-main:after{background-color:#f5f5f5;bottom:0;content:"";height:20px;left:0;position:absolute;right:0;z-index:5}
/*# sourceMappingURL=main.49178be3.css.map*/